Selecting the Right Wi-Fi and Bluetooth Projector
Choosing the best projector for your needs can seem intimidating with the myriad of alternatives readily available. Here is a comparative table that breaks down a few of the most popular designs presently on the marketplace, highlighting their crucial features:
Projector ModelResolutionBrightness (ANSI Lumens)Wi-FiBluetoothPrice RangeEpson Home Cinema 21501080p (1920x1080)2500YesYes₤ 800 - ₤ 1,000ViewSonic M1 Mini Plus854 x 480250YesYes₤ 300 - ₤ 400LG PF50KA1080p (1920x1080)600YesYes₤ 600 - ₤ 800BenQ GS2720p (1280x720)500YesYes₤ 500 - ₤ 700Anker Nebula Capsule854 x 480100YesYes₤ 300 - ₤ 500Factors to Consider
When picking a projector, think about the following elements:

Resolution: Higher resolution projectors deliver sharper and more detailed images. For home movie theater, look for at least 1080p, while business settings might discover 720p adequate.

Brightness: Measured in ANSI lumens, brightness is crucial for clear image quality, especially in well-lit environments. A projector with a minimum of 2,500 lumens is advised for discussions in intense rooms.

Mobility: If you plan to use the projector in various areas, think about a compact and light-weight model with long battery life.
